Bagley Downs — Weather conditions were not great — a morning snow, chilly winds and intermittent rain — but AmeriCorps women kept digging hundreds of weeds. Melissa Princehouse, Julie Pachico and Lindsey Thompson, AmeriCorps staff for the Boys & Girls Clubs of Southwest Washington, and Jessica Latus, AmeriCorps member with Vancouver Watersheds Alliance, prepared a planting bed for the fifth-grade Young Women in Action program at Roosevelt Elementary School. The volunteers worked in the planting bed at the Jim Parsley Community Center as a service project for AmeriCorps Service Week, March 10-18.
Later this spring, the students will plant herbs donated by the horticulture programs at Lewis and Clark and Fort Vancouver high schools.
Young Women in Action is a mentoring program of the Foundation for Vancouver Public Schools.
